Maison >interface Web >js tutoriel >JQuery peut-il être utilisé pour la manipulation DOM côté serveur avec Node.js ?

JQuery peut-il être utilisé pour la manipulation DOM côté serveur avec Node.js ?

Patricia Arquette
Patricia Arquetteoriginal
2024-11-16 15:54:03501parcourir

Can jQuery be Used for Server-Side DOM Manipulation with Node.js?

Utiliser jQuery avec Node.js

Est-il possible d'utiliser des sélecteurs jQuery et d'effectuer des manipulations DOM côté serveur avec Node.js ?

Oui, c'est possible. Pour y parvenir, plusieurs étapes sont nécessaires :

1. Installer les dépendances

Exécutez les commandes suivantes dans le terminal pour installer les dépendances nécessaires :

npm install jquery jsdom

2. Intégrez jQuery

Importez les modules jsdom et jquery :

const { JSDOM } = require('jsdom');
const { window } = new JSDOM();
const { document } = (new JSDOM('')).window;

global.document = document;
const $ = jQuery = require('jquery')(window);

En définissant global.document et en important jQuery de cette manière, cela permet à jQuery de fonctionner côté serveur.

Reportez-vous à la réponse fournie pour plus de détails et un exemple d'implémentation de l'utilisation de sélecteurs jQuery et de la manipulation du DOM dans un environnement Node.js.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n